Bars and Boutiques: The Classic Dubai Dating Duo:

Dubai's nightlife is legendary. Hit a rooftop bar with stunning views, (avoid excessive PDA, you're not in a Bollywood movie), and enjoy some conversation under the Dubai sky. If you're feeling more low-key, browse a quirky art gallery or explore a bustling souk. Who knows, you might just find your soulmate haggling over a pashmina scarf!

Keep in mind: Public displays of affection are a bit of a gray area in Dubai. A quick hug or holding hands is generally okay, but anything more might raise eyebrows.

How to stay safe on a date in Dubai?

Just like anywhere else, use common sense. Meet in public places for first dates, let someone know where you're going, and trust your gut instinct.
